Despite a seemingly presumptive coronation of Benghazi bungler-in-chief Hillary Clinton as the Democratic candidate for president in 2016, a few other possibilities are queuing up.

They aren’t promising.

Self-described “Democratic Socialist” Bernie Sanders of Vermont has thrown his hat in the ring. Earning a solid “F” from NRA-ILA, he voted for the 1994 Crime Bill (including the so-called assault weapons ban) and a long list of other restrictions. Now—oddly—he purportedly “cares that other people care about guns” and “thinks there’s an elitism in the anti-gun movement.” Is he referring to the “it’s-more-important-for-me-to-feel-safe-than-you-to-be-safe” taxpayer-paid/private personal security crowd?

Elitism, eh? There's a shocker.
